5. Lexus GS

Lexus has many models under different initials like CT, IS, GS, LS, RC, and LC.

All of the initials have names according to their features Intelligent Sport(IS), Luxury Saloon(LS), Luxury Coupe(LC), Compact Touring(CT), Racing Coupe(RC), and lastly Grand Sport(GS).

Like ES, the Lexus GS is a mid-size luxury sedan that can drive perfectly well in harsh road and weather conditions.

The GS sedan is a sports car equipped with the engine of a 3.5-liter V-6 engine. 

The powerful engine delivers 280 lb-ft of torque and 311 horsepower.

All-wheel drive (AWD) and rear-wheel drive (RWD) options are available. It can cover 0 to 60 mph in 5.8 seconds. 

The drive inside the GS is smooth and elegant as it manages the road pretty sturdily with its three different drive modes Eco, Sport, and Normal.

These modes will make the drive more suitable according to the situation.

9. Volvo S60

The Volvo S60 is available in the market in a single variant of T4 Inscription.

This new model provides originality to luxury sedans, making the car stand out in a crowd of cars with its designs.

The car’s engine is a 2.0-liter turbo-petrol motor with four cylinders.

There’s an 8-speed automatic transmission present in the vehicle. All of these produce 188bhp. The car has a Front-Wheel Drive (FWD) drivetrain.

As it is distinct in terms of all designs, then the interior and exterior are both unique.

The exterior consists of Thor Hammer design of headlamps, revised front bumper, chequered grille, and many such special features.

The interior has Android Auto, and Apple CarPlay with a 9″ touchscreen infotainment system.

It is vertically mounted on the dashboard, 14-way adjustable front seats, and two memory presets. Also, there’s wireless charging.

The S60 model of the Volvo is called a dynamic sedan. These features include lane keep assist, adaptive cruise control, and autonomous emergency braking.

11. Audi RS3

Audi is presented as a fantastic option for sport, and as well as a sedan car, the new Audi RS3 is a mixture of both.

While giving the sport, the vehicle has the best speed control and drift options; also, on the other hand, the sedan features are there.

It has the engine of 2.5-liter turbocharged with an unusual five-cylinder engine.

It creates the maximum power of 401 horsepower­. The machine is connected to an automatic transmission of a seven-speed dual-clutch.

The passenger arrangement of the car is similar to the A3 and S3 models of Audi.

The display mounted in the cabin is a 10.1-inch touchscreen. It can be controlled by voice commands, touch inputs, and buttons on the steering wheel.

The safety and the exterior of the car are both approved by the drivers.

Protection includes automatic high-beam headlights, adaptive cruise control, and driver-assistance technology.

The warranty is limited to 50,000 miles or four years.
